我试图按照此处的说明将istio sidecar手动注入到现有部署中:
https://istio.io/docs/setup/kubernetes/additional-setup/sidecar-injection
但是,我遇到以下错误:
$ istioctl kube-inject -f k8s/prod/deployment.yaml
Error: missing configuration map key "values" in "istio-sidecar-injector"
即使我尝试使用不同的Yaml文件尝试不同的类型,我也会出现此错误。这是一个错误还是我做错了什么?如何在配置图中添加“值”?
答案 0 :(得分:1)
检查群集中安装的istioctl
二进制文件(istioctl version
)与istio的版本:如果它们不同,则可能会收到此错误消息(或类似消息)。